György Kurtág, a renowned figure in the classical music world, presents a captivating collection of works in "Ligeti & Kurtág at Carnegie Hall." Released on January 1, 2010, under the BMC Records label, this album is a testament to Kurtág's mastery of classical piano and composition. Spanning a concise yet impactful 66 minutes, the album features a diverse range of pieces, including the intricate "Messages of the Late R. V. Troussova, Op. 17," a 21-track suite that showcases Kurtág's ability to convey deep emotion and complexity through minimalist compositions. The album also includes the powerful "Cello concerto" and the evocative "Four Poems by Anna Akhmatova, Op. 41," demonstrating Kurtág's versatility and depth as a composer.
